The Area Credit Manager will be responsible for underwriting and managing the credit evaluation process for unsecured business loan proposals within the assigned geography. The role focuses on ensuring high-quality portfolio growth while maintaining risk standards and policy compliance.
Key Responsibilities:
Assess and underwrite unsecured business loan applications (BL) within defined TAT
Analyze financial statements, bank statements, and customer profiles for creditworthiness
Evaluate risk based on bureau reports (CIBIL), cash flows, and business stability
Approve/recommend cases within delegated authority and escalate deviations
Ensure adherence to internal credit policies and regulatory guidelines
Maintain portfolio quality by minimizing early delinquencies (EMI bounce, 0–30 DPD)
Work closely with sales teams to guide on credit norms and policy changes
Conduct personal discussions (PD) and field visits for high-value or risky cases
Monitor fraud triggers and ensure proper due diligence
Provide feedback to policy team for continuous improvement
